P.S. Visual Basic with its GUI designer was a quite effective way to rapidly build apps of questionable quality but great business value. Somebody should bring that paradigm back.
My day job is programming in an environment which originated in the mid 90s. A contemporary of the Visual Basic era, but somewhat more powerful, and requiring substantially less code.
While I, and a few thousand others still use it (and it gets updated every couple years or so) it has never been fashionable. Ironically because it's perceived as 'not real programming'.
We routinely build systems with hundreds of thousands of lines of code, much of it founded in the 90s and having been added to for 25 years. Most of it was built, and worked on, by individuals, or very small teams. Much of it today is still active doing the boring business software that keep the lights on.
But its not "main stream" because programmers pick language based on popularity, and enterprises pick programmers based on language. A self-fueling cycle of risk aversion.
A lucky few though hot off the treadmill a long time ago and "followed a path less travelled by". And that has made all the difference.